AutoGen
Microsoft's multi-agent framework for building conversational AI systems, this open-source platform revolutionizes workflow automation by enabling developers to create sophisticated AI-powered applications without prohibitive costs. AutoGen provides a powerful foundation for constructing complex conversational systems where multiple AI agents collaborate intelligently to solve problems, automate tasks, and enhance business processes. By eliminating the need for expensive proprietary solutions, this framework democratizes access to advanced AI capabilities, allowing organizations of all sizes to leverage cutting-edge multi-agent technology for their automation needs. The platform delivers comprehensive features designed for seamless agent collaboration and workflow orchestration. AutoGen enables customizable agent creation with flexible communication patterns, supports integration with various language models and external tools, and provides robust debugging capabilities for monitoring agent interactions. Users benefit from built-in conversation management, sophisticated task handling mechanisms, and the ability to define complex workflows where agents coordinate efforts to achieve specific objectives. The framework's architecture supports both synchronous and asynchronous agent operations, ensuring flexibility across diverse automation scenarios. Langflow
This visual framework empowers developers to build sophisticated multi-agent and RAG (Retrieval-Augmented Generation) applications without extensive coding. Langflow streamlines workflow automation by providing an intuitive, drag-and-drop interface that transforms complex AI development into an accessible process. The platform's core value lies in dramatically reducing development time while maintaining flexibility and control over application architecture, making enterprise-grade AI solutions achievable for teams of all technical skill levels. The platform delivers comprehensive features designed for modern AI development, including visual component composition, seamless integration with multiple language models and data sources, and real-time debugging capabilities. Users benefit from pre-built templates, customizable workflows, and a modular architecture that supports rapid prototyping and iteration. The framework handles multi-agent orchestration elegantly, allowing developers to create sophisticated conversational systems and knowledge retrieval pipelines through intuitive visual design rather than manual configuration.
